On August 11, 2014, CPA Global, the world’s leading specialist in intellectual property (IP) software and services, announced the acquisition of international patent services provider Landon IP for an undisclosed amount. The acquisition further strengthens CPA Global’s patent search and analytics capabilities, while providing Landon IP with access to a larger worldwide network.

Landon IP is headquartered in Alexandria, Virginia, close to CPA Global’s US headquarters and the US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O). It also has offices in Detroit, Michigan, as well as internationally, in London, Tokyo, Shanghai and New Delhi. Landon IP was previously wholly owned by the Company’s Chief Executive Officer, David Hunt, and other Hunt family interests. Hunt and fellow members of Landon IP’s management team will continue in their current roles.

The primary services that Landon IP offers are:

  • Patent search
    Patent searches for corporates, law firms, universities, and inventors to provide them with a more informed view on such issues as patentability, infringement, freedom to operate, state of the art and validity.
  • Patent Cooperation Treaty (PCT) search
    Execution of Chapter I PCT International Search Reports under long-term contract to the USPTO.
  • Patent analytics
    Complex patent analysis – including patent landscape studies, patent mapping and portfolio reviews – to support decision-making around patent strategy, research and development, patent valuations, and licensing or sale of patents.
  • Intellectual Property information retrieval and legal support
    Professional information retrieval, IP data collection searches and monitoring, and dissemination of worldwide value-added patent file histories through its proprietary Patent Workbench® tool.
  • Patent law education
    Introductory and advanced patent law courses and educational programs for patent professionals through its Patent Resources Group subsidiary.

Following the acquisition, Landon IP will operate as a standalone entity and will continue to serve clients in the same manner as previously. CPA Global’s management teams will work with Hunt and his team to expand Landon IP’s geographic reach and help promote the Company’s specialist skills to a broader range of clients worldwide.

About Landon IP

Landon IP is a leading global provider of professional support services throughout the IP lifecycle. Services include patent and trademark searching; non-patent literature searching; in-depth technical analysis; and global information retrieval. The Company is headquartered in Alexandria, Virginia, near the offices of the US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O), with other offices in Detroit, Michigan, the UK (London), Japan (Tokyo), China (Shanghai) and India (New Delhi).

In 2006, Landon IP was awarded a contract to conduct PCT patent searches for the USPTO in the fields of mechanical engineering, life sciences, physical sciences, and electrical communications. Landon IP’s relationship with the USPTO was extended and expanded in 2012 with the award of a new contract to perform PCT searches across all of the USPTO’s technology areas.

The Company that is today Landon IP traces its history back to 1949 when a predecessor to the present company was founded in the US. For further information, please visit: www.landon-ip.com

Landon IP is excited to announce that Atsushi Nozaki, the Senior Director of Landon IP GK, was recently elected to be a member of the Board of Directors of the Federation of Patent Information Suppliers (FPIS).  Mr. Nozaki is very well-known and respected by the IP community in Japan.  He is frequently invited to lecture on patent-related topics by many IP organizations in Japan.  This latest honor is further evidence of his standing among his peers.

FPIS is based in Tokyo and currently has 19 member organizations.  FPIS members primarily represent companies that provide patent information-related services, such as patent searching, databases, and intellectual property software.  In addition to Landon IP, current members include Thomson, RWS, Aztec, and the Korea Techno Agency, as well as some Japanese patent law firms, such as Sakamoto International, Eikoh and IRD International.

FPIS holds meetings in January, April, June, August, and November every year to discuss current topics of interest in the patent information industry.  In August they have an annual meeting with representatives of the Japan Patent Office (JPO) to review policies impacting patent information.  They also host seminars relating to patent searching and analysis.

Mr. Kartar Arora, a patent analyst with Landon IP, Inc. will be sharing his expertise with the patent searching community at next week’s PIUG 2014 Annual Conference.  This event will be held from April 26 through May 1 at the Hyatt Regency Orange County in Garden Grove, California.  The theme of this year’s conference is “Patent Knowledge & IP Strategy: Riding the Waves of Change to Achieve Business Success”.

Mr. Arora will be presenting on Tuesday, April 29 at 3:05pm on the topic, “Searching for Post-Grant Events in the Life of a Patent”.  The amount of legal status data on granted patents and published patent applications that is available on line is growing.  Patenting authorities make such information available on their websites, and various free and subscription-based online resources also provide access to legal status information.  Mr. Arora’s presentation will explain how to most effectively leverage these various resources given the challenges involved, drawing on real-world examples.  The abstract of his presentation is available on the conference website.

Mr. Arora holds a Ph.D. in Polymer Science and Chemistry from the University of Michigan and is a Registered Patent Agent.  In addition to his patent searching expertise, he has experience with patent prosecution, drafting of patent applications, monitoring and coordination of patenting activities, and patent management systems.

Atsushi Nozaki, Senior Director of Landon IP GK, is scheduled to give a lecture on the topic “Utilizing Patent Maps for Business Strategy and Patent Filing Strategy” on February 7, 2014.  The event is being sponsored by the Japan Institute for Promoting Invention and Innovation and will take place in their Seminar Room in Toranomon, Tokyo.

Mr. Nozaki summarizes the event as follows:

It is important to utilize both non-patent information and patent information, especially patent mapping, when developing business strategies and patent filing strategies.  However, patent mapping alone doesn’t guarantee a good business strategy — we should also consider frameworks such as Porter’s five forces and value chain theory and learn how to develop innovative ideas.  This seminar emphasizes group work, rather than classroom lecture, and is designed to help attendees learn effectively through the group work experiences.
